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from North Sheen to Porth start from as little as £27.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from North Sheen to Porth start from £57.10 one way, or £99.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from North Sheen to Porth are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Facilities at North Sheen Station

While North Sheen station might not boast a lavish old-world charm, it offers practical amenities to ensure a seamless travel experience. For those looking to purchase tickets, the station has a ticket office with limited opening hours—Monday through Friday, from 06:45 to 10:30. Fortunately, ticket machines are available for ticket purchases and the collection of online bookings any time of the day.

Accessibility at North Sheen may be a concern for some travelers since the station lacks step-free access. Additionally, there are no accessible ticket machines or waiting rooms on site. However, North Sheen does cater to some accessibility needs with induction loops and ramps for train access.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Porth train station is equipped to cater to the needs of modern-day travellers. It lacks a traditional ticket office, but fear not! Ticket machines are available for you to collect tickets purchased online. Plus, these ticket machines are accessible to all, accepting payments via major debit and credit cards only. While there are no facilities for cash transactions, the presence of an induction loop ensures clear communication for everyone.

In terms of accessibility, Porth station is classified as Category A, offering step-free access throughout. Although there’s no waiting room or refreshment facilities, you can find customer help points that assist with any information or support you might need. CCTV surveillance adds an extra layer of safety as you navigate through the station. While luggage storage isn't provided, any lost property can be reported through Transport for Wales Lost Property Service.

Transport Links and Connections

Porth serves as a well-connected hub with links to other transport modes. There's a rail replacement service with local bus connections heading towards Dinas Rhondda and Trehafod. For those aiming to explore further, bus stops close to the station offer routes to Caerphilly, Gilfach Goch, and Maerdy, located approximately 150 meters from the station.
